Today we ventured out on a school bird boat and we were rewarded with a Red-throated Diver feeding just off Shipstal Beach, Arne plus 3 Great Northern Diver out in central harbour. There were a minimum of 25 Spoonbill on Shipstal Point, Arne and out in central harbour, Goldeneye, Red-breasted merganser and Great Crested Grebe numbers continue to grow. A Merlin was being harassed out in Brands Bay by a crow and 3 Marsh Harrier came out of the west Poole Harbour roost. The redhead Smew was again present in Holes Bay south with 3 Goldeneye. A male Merlin zoomed past Middlebere and at Lytchett Pools there was still a minimum of 2 Water Pipit with 1 Green Sandpiper and a Marsh Harrier passed over.
